"Just a Moment" was released as the third single from Nas’s critically acclaimed 2004 double album, Street's Disciple . The track served a dual purpose: it acted as a deeply personal tribute to those lost to violence and tragedy, and it acted as the official introduction of rapper Quan to the mainstream hip-hop audience. 1. Ferquan Clifford Peacock, known professionally as Quan (or Don Ferquan), is an American rapper and singer who was catapulted into the spotlight by his collaboration with Nas. Born in Bridgeport, Connecticut, and raised in Newport News, Virginia, Quan's life before music was marked by severe hardship, including a seven-year prison sentence that he served before his career began.
